Mesothelioma

Mesothelioma, a rare but fatal cancer is a disease of the lining of the abdomen or lungs. It has been linked to asbestos exposure. This disease is caused by inhaling asbestos fibers floating in the air. These particles can end up in the lungs, causing inflammation or tumors. Asbestos was used in the past in a wide range of industrial and construction materials. It is a naturally occurring mineral fiber that is prized for its heat resistance and malleable strength. Before it was banned, asbestos was used in a variety of places, including ships, power plants and buildings. Asbestos was inhaled by workers in these industries when they handled the products or shipped them to other locations.

In Maryland, asbestos was found in shipyards. The work in these facilities was carried out in cramped conditions and were not equipped with proper ventilation. Workers were exposed to asbestos dust through packing, gaskets and other asbestos-containing products. Asbestos victims in these shipyards also were at risk of developing respiratory diseases as well as cancers of the chest and lung.

Social Security Disability

A Baltimore asbestos lawyer can assist you in applying for disability benefits if your asbestos exposure has left you too sick to be able to work. This is a different type of program than workers’ compensation. Both programs require proof of exposure to asbestos and a medical diagnosis of mesothelioma or another asbestos-related diseases. In addition to providing documentation, you should submit specific information regarding your symptoms and treatment. Your lawyer can help understand the specific requirements for each.

To qualify to be eligible for SSDI you must show that your condition is likely to last or has lasted for at least one year, and that it will result in death. In the majority of cases, mesothelioma is likely to be able to meet this condition. You must also prove that the illness is so severe that you are unable to work. Asbestos trust funds are set up to pay compensation to victims of asbestos-related injuries. They are usually set up to settle claims against companies that have been forced to close due to asbestos lawsuits.
